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To simply and firmly mount a cushion body to the seatback or the seat of a chair from the rear without using a fixing screw, a fixing metal fitting, etc. and to prevent the design of the seatback or the seat from being restricted. SOLUTION: A folded part 7a facing the direction of the side of a shell 5 is formed at the edge part of the cushion body 7, an elastically bendable engaging piece 12 having an engaging pawl 11 facing the direction of the part 7a at its tip is projectingly provided on the rear surface of a core material 8, the part 7a is abutted on the edge of a corresponding shell 5, the piece 12 is fitted into an engaging hole 6 formed at the shell 5 and the pawl 11 is engaged with an edge 6a on the side of the rear surface of the hole 6.
